Siemens SINUMERIK 840D sl Function Manual page 883

Hide thumbs Also See for SINUMERIK 840D sl:
Table of Contents

Advertisement

DB19.DBB17 = <program number>
● user area: 1 - 100
● individual area: 101 - 200 (only SINUMERIK 828D)
● oem area: 201 - 255
Requesting program selection
DB19.DBX13.7 = 1
Program selection: Acknowledgment interface
Job acknowledgment
● DB19.DBX26.7 == 1 (selection identified)
● DB19.DBX26.3 == 1 (program is selected)
● DB19.DBX26.2 == 1 (error when selecting the program, see error ID DB19.DBB27)
● DB19.DBX26.1 == 1 ((job completed)
Error detection
DB19.DBB27 == <error ID>
Error detection
Value
Program selection: Job processing
A job to select a program is executed as follows:
1. Checking the acknowledgment byte: DB19.DBB26 == 0
If the acknowledgment byte is not 0, then the last job has still not been completed.
2. Specifying the program list: DB19.DBB16
3. Specifying the program number: DB19.DBB17
4. Setting the request to select a program: DB19.DBX13.7 = 1
5. Evaluating the acknowledgment and error interface: DB19.DBB26 and .DBB27
The order is still not completed on the HMI side as long as: DB19.DBX26.3 == 1 (active)
The order has been completed on the HMI side if one of the two signals has been set:
- DB19.DBX26.1 == 1 (OK)
- DB19.DBX26.2 == 1 (error)
Basic Functions
Function Manual, 01/2015, 6FC5397-0BP40-5BA2
Meaning
0
No error
1
Invalid program list number (DB19.DBB16)
3
User specification Program list plc_proglist_main.ppl not found (only for DB19.DBB16 ≠ 1,
2, 3)
4
Invalid program number (DB19.DBB17)
5
Job list in the selected workpiece could not be opened.
6
Error in job list (job list interpreter returns error).
7
Job list interpreter returns empty job list.
P3: Basic PLC program for SINUMERIK 840D sl
13.13 PLC functions for HMI
883

Hide quick links:

Advertisement

Table of Contents
loading

This manual is also suitable for:

Sinumerik 828dSinumerik 840de sl

Table of Contents